JavaScript Performance Optimization

JavaScript Performance Optimization: JavaScript is a popular programming language that is widely used in web development. As the internet continues to evolve, the demand for faster and more efficient web applications has increased. Performance optimization is crucial for delivering a better user experience and achieving business goals. In this blog post, we will discuss the different techniques you can use to optimize the performance of your JavaScript code.

Minimize HTTP Requests

Every time a user visits your website, their browser sends a request to the server for every file needed to display the page. This includes HTML, CSS, and JavaScript files. The more requests a browser has to make, the slower the website will load. To minimize the number of requests, you can combine all your JavaScript files into a single file. This reduces the number of requests, which leads to faster load times.


Optimize Your Code

One of the most effective ways to optimize the performance of your JavaScript code is to write efficient code. There are several best practices you can follow to optimize your code:

  • Use efficient data structures and algorithms
  • Use loops instead of recursion
  • Avoid using global variables
  • Use short variable names
  • Avoid nested loops and conditions
    By following these best practices, you can make your code more efficient and reduce its execution time.

Use a CDN

A Content Delivery Network (CDN) is a network of servers located around the world that stores cached versions of your website’s files. When a user visits your website, the files are delivered from the server closest to them, which reduces latency and improves load times. You can use a CDN to host your JavaScript files and improve their performance.

See also  The Future of Programming: How ChatGPT is Changing the Game (ChatGPT and programming)

Use Asynchronous Loading

JavaScript can block the rendering of a webpage until it has finished executing. This can slow down the page load time and affect the user experience. To avoid this, you can use asynchronous loading. Asynchronous loading allows the browser to continue rendering the page while the JavaScript is loading. This improves the perceived performance of the website and makes it feel faster.

read also: DOM Fundamentals (DOM Manipulations)

Use Lazy Loading

Lazy loading is a technique that allows you to defer the loading of images and other resources until they are needed. This reduces the initial load time of the page and improves its performance. You can use lazy loading for JavaScript code as well. By only loading the JavaScript code that is needed for a particular page, you can improve its performance and reduce its load time.


In conclusion, JavaScript performance optimization is critical for delivering a better user experience and achieving business goals. By following these best practices, you can make your JavaScript code more efficient, reduce its execution time, and improve the overall performance of your website. Remember to test your code regularly to ensure it is performing optimally and make changes as needed.

Read also: How to chat on WhatsApp without saving the Mobile Number

Like and Follow Us on Facebook: Flourish Tech-House

Originally posted 2023-03-20 12:34:39.



Leave a Reply

Your email address will not be published. Required fields are marked *